Is Brambleghast Good in Scarlet & Violet Playthrough?

Grass/Ghost Brambleghast brings decent Attack with Wind Rider turning Tailwind into a free Attack boost. Handles Water and Ground encounters. The typing gives two immunities (Normal, Fighting) and useful coverage against Psychic.

Brambleghast Weakness

Brambleghast's Grass/Ghost typing leaves it vulnerable to Fire, Ice, Flying, Ghost, and Dark. It shrugs off Normal and Fighting-type attacks completely. The Grass/Ghost typing picks up 4 resistances to work with. Brambleghast leans offensive (base 115 Atk) rather than trying to tank its weaknesses.

Abilities
Wind Rider
Gives immunity to wind moves, and causes the Pokémon's Attack to increase by one stage when hit by one.
InfiltratorHidden Ability
Bypasses light screen, reflect, and safeguard.

Pokedex Entry

It will open the branches of its head to envelop its prey. Once it absorbs all the life energy it needs, it expels the prey and discards it.

Brambleghast wanders around arid regions. On rare occasions, mass outbreaks of these Pokémon will bury an entire town.
